Genetic and Physiological Characteristics

Long-term Lifecycle 🌱

California Sunset Coleonema is a resilient plant that can thrive for several years, often exceeding a decade under optimal conditions. Its growth cycle features a dormant phase in winter, followed by a burst of activity in spring and summer.

Growth Patterns Specific to Coleonema 🌿

This evergreen shrub typically reaches heights and widths of up to 3 feet, making it a compact yet impactful addition to any garden. Throughout the year, its foliage undergoes seasonal color shifts, providing visual interest that keeps your landscape vibrant.

Reproductive Strategies and Seed Production 🌼

Coleonema produces small, star-like flowers that not only beautify the garden but also attract essential pollinators. Its ability to produce seeds continuously during the growing season reinforces its classification as a perennial, ensuring a steady cycle of growth and renewal.

Variations and Exceptions

🌱 Conditions Where California Sunset Coleonema May Be Treated as an Annual

California Sunset Coleonema can sometimes behave like an annual due to environmental stressors. Extreme cold or prolonged drought can lead to dieback, making it appear as if it has completed its lifecycle in a single season.

Poor soil conditions can also impact its growth and longevity. When the soil lacks nutrients or drainage, the plant may struggle, mimicking the behavior of true annuals that don’t survive adverse conditions.

🌍 Regional Differences Affecting Its Classification

This plant thrives in Mediterranean climates, showcasing its adaptability. It flourishes in regions with similar weather patterns, making it a popular choice for those areas.

However, local climate and soil types can lead to variability in growth patterns. Depending on these factors, the California Sunset Coleonema may exhibit different characteristics, further complicating its classification as a perennial.

Management Tips for Longevity

🌱 Best Practices for Managing California Sunset Coleonema as a Perennial

To ensure your California Sunset Coleonema thrives, focus on its soil requirements. It prefers well-draining soil with poor to moderate fertility, making it ideal for low-maintenance gardens.

Watering is another key factor. This plant is drought-tolerant, so once established, water sparingly to avoid over-saturation.

🌼 Tips for Maximizing Its Longevity in the Garden

Regular pruning is essential for encouraging bushy growth and vibrant flowering. Trim back the plant to promote a fuller shape and enhance its visual appeal.

Pest management is crucial for maintaining plant health. Keep an eye out for common pests and diseases, addressing any issues promptly to prevent damage.
